Re: Soundcards vs Onboard Audio - DEFINITIVE ANSWER?

My mobo has onboard Realtek 889a with supposed SNR of over 105db.

Only empirical, but when playing through analogue to my old high grade amp and speaker, there is distinct background noise. This was never there using my previous sound card.
